BOM fabric requirements 2009
THE QUILT SHOW: STARS FOR A NEW DAY
FABRIC REQUIREMENTS
QUILT SIZE: Approx. 85 x 85 inches
Fabric Required Use
6-1/2 yards Background
1-1/4 yards -Feathered star setting triangles; setting triangles for 6-inch blocks -
3/4 yards -Setting triangles for 6-inch star blocks
1-1/2 yards -Feathered star feathers, four-patches, pinwheels, star
blocks, flying geese, floater borders, and log cabin blocks
1-1/2 yards - Center of feathered star; floater borders
3/8 yard -Four-patch setting triangles
1/2 yard -Feathered star points, 4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ks,
flying geese, and log cabin blocks
3/8 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ese
2 yards -Floater border, 4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ying
geese, and quilt binding
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ying geese, and log
cabin blocks
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ying geese, and log
cabin blocks
3/8 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ard - 4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ard - 4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1 1/2 yard -Floater border, 4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, and flying geese -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ying geese, and log
cabin blocks -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ying geese, and log
cabin blocks -
1/2 yard -4-patches, pinwheels, star blocks, flying geese, and log
cabin blocks
Note: Fabric list includes fabric for the quilt binding.Tags: None

You all know that I was honored to "test" the pattern for Sue, and have finished my 2009 BOM, so I can tell you that if you are making a scrappy quilt, the yardages are not critical! I didn't have enough of my background fabric (a soft yellow) and used two different backgrounds on some of the borders!
